Children's eye exams are different from adult exams, focusing on developmental milestones, eye teaming skills, and detecting issues that could affect learning and coordination.

The American Optometric Association recommends a comprehensive eye exam at 6 months, 3 years, before first grade, and then annually. Be observant of signs like squinting, frequent eye rubbing, tilting the head, or avoiding near-vision tasks like reading, which could indicate a need for an evaluation.
